Interview

Q: Why did you decide to join your names together, to create one author?

A: Our publisher actually suggested it, so we chose Laurelin McGee instead of making up a new pen name so that it would be easier for fans of our solo work to see that it was us. Plus, it just sounded better than Kayti Paige.

Q: What did you like most about working together to create Miss Match?

A: The laughs! Although we generally always know what the other one is writing, it's always a surprise to see exactly how a scene turns out. More often than not, every time we emailed each other the next chapter, there would be a barrage of "lol" texts to follow.

Q: What qualities would be in your perfect match?

As two super-busy writers, someone supportive who doesn't mind doing the laundry is key! Laurelin likes tall, skinny guys (like her husband) and Kayti likes tattooed Brits. She's also single, if any of you want to play Miss Match yourself. ;)
